troopoleon8897 10-26-2005, 04:16 PM Earlier this year on February 8th, Warner Bros. Released a ton Sitcoms on DVD as part of their 50th Anniversary. These were the shows released:
The Fresh Prince Of Bel-Air: Season 1
Full House: Season 1
The Jamie Foxx Show: Season 1
Murphy Brown: Season 1
Night Court: Season 1
The Wayans Bros: Season 1
Since then these have been further released:
The Fresh Prince Of Bel-Air: Season 2 (October 11th)
Full House: Season 2 (December 6th)
Now Three more Warner Bros. Releases have been annouced:
Growing Pains: Season 1 (February 7th)
The Fresh Prince Of Bel-Air: Season 2 (February 14th)
Living Single: Season 1 (February 14th)
